Understanding Discipline in Forex Trading

Discipline in forex trading refers to the ability of a trader to adhere to a predetermined set of rules and strategies consistently. It involves following a trading plan, managing risks effectively, and making informed decisions based on analysis rather than emotions. Discipline acts as a guiding force that keeps traders focused and helps them navigate the uncertainties of the forex market with confidence.

Tips to Developing a Solid Trading Discipline

1. Mastering Self-Control and Emotional Management

Forex trading is a dynamic environment that can evoke strong emotions such as greed and fear. Successful traders understand the significance of mastering self-control and emotional management. By carefully studying the forex markets,  traders can gain a deeper understanding of market dynamics and reduce emotional impulses. Patience is a key aspect of discipline, enabling traders to wait for high-probability trade setups and avoid impulsive decisions driven by emotions.

To maintain discipline, traders should create a well-defined trading plan and adhere to it strictly. This involves setting a trading schedule, identifying signals for entry and exit, and implementing proper risk management techniques like stop loss and take profit orders. Following the rules without trying to “outsmart” the market is crucial for consistent success in forex trading.

4. Implementing Stop Loss Orders and Risk Management.

Using a stop-loss order is a critical aspect of disciplined forex trading. Traders must define their stop-loss levels before entering a trade and never adjust them to keep a position open. The discipline of adhering to stop-loss levels protects traders from excessive losses and prevents emotional decision-making driven by the desire to turn losing positions profitable. Effective risk management ensures that traders do not risk more than they can afford to lose, enhancing overall discipline.
